Kevin Nash – ‘AEW Collision Ratings Aren’t Bad’

During the latest edition of his “Kliq This” podcast, Kevin Nash commented on loads of topics including AEW’s recent ratings for Collision and why they aren’t all that bad.


Of course, AEW Collision will face stiff competition this time of year with a ton of college football games airing head-to-head. For example, this past Saturday night saw big college football games airing in primetime on CBS, ABC, FOX, NBC, ESPN, and many other networks.


Additionally, Kevin Nash commented on the WWE “superfan” Vladimir Abouzeide’s documentary and often sees him at WWE live events.


You can check out some highlights from the podcast below:


On the accomplishment of the episode overall: “I was thinking, they still did a half million views. People are such a**holes, ‘It was against the World Series,’ and then in the next paragraph the guy goes, ‘It was the least viewed World Series game ever.’ They’ve always got something.”


On Vladimir Abouzeide’s documentary: “He was already there [at the events], he was always a very pleasant person. He always had that incredible, infectious smile on his face. He was a superfan.”
